Type of LED & Different Waterproof IP Grade
- Non-waterproof (IP20): Bare strip, self-adhesive backing, for indoor/dry use.
- Waterproof IP65: Surface covered with gel, self-adhesive backing, protects from sprayed water from all directions.
- Waterproof IP67: Strip enclosed in a hollow silicone tube, sealed at both ends; suitable for short-term immersion in water.
- Waterproof IP68: Strip enclosed in U-shape silicone tube, covered with silicone gel, sealed at both ends; suitable for underwater use.
Installation Tips
- Always disconnect power supply before cutting/connecting LED Light Strips.
- Do not crimp strip tape, attempt to bend strips width-wise, or length-wise to a radius less than 15mm.
- Do not connect LED Light Strips directly to 120V AC power.
- Apply power to test LED Light Strips before mounting.
How to Power / Control the Strip
When selecting a transformer:
- Choose wattage based on how many LED strips you need to power.
- It is recommended to select a transformer with higher wattage than the total rated power of the strips to avoid full-load operation.
- Using a higher wattage transformer does not harm the strips and is safer for longevity.
